The November 1999 Netcraft Web Server Survey is out;
http://www.netcraft.com/survey/
- Top placed developers with numbers of hosts responding and percentage share -
Developer November 1999 Percent Change
Apache 4847992 54.81 1.14
Microsoft 2145461 24.26 -0.67
Netscape 653800 7.39 -0.34
- Top placed servers with numbers of hosts responding and percentage share -
Server November 1999 Percent Change
Apache 4847992 54.81 1.14
Microsoft-IIS 2141099 24.21 -0.67
Netscape-Enterprise 597058 6.75 0.22
thttpd 176358 1.99 0.17
Rapidsite 165222 1.87 0.03
Zeus 115307 1.30 0.05
CnG 104979 1.19 -0.34
WebSitePro 89324 1.01 -0.09
Stronghold 77248 0.87 -0.04
WebSTAR 67993 0.77 -0.02
Around the Net
[1]Apache had its best month since the spring, gaining just over one
percentage point of survey share. [2]Microsoft, after its large gain
last month, and [3]Netscape dropped back by a roughly equivalent
measure.
During the month promotion commenced for the second Apache
[4]conference to be run in Florida next March. It is interesting to
see that [5]Sun , traditionally thought of as tightly aligned with
Netscape, is adopting a more encouraging outlook towards Apache and is
a conference sponsor.
Large Scale Hosting
Last month we reported that [6]webjump.com was one of the first large
hosting systems [with well over 300,000 sites] to be deployed on NT.
Several people have since pointed out that Webjump is actually a
hybrid system with static content run from [7]NT and dynamic content
delivered from a [8]conventional Solaris/Apache/perl system.
In the upshot of the publicity of the Webjump system, several
companies changed their DNS configurations to enable Netcraft to
retrieve DNS information for their web hosts and include their sites
in the survey; the largest of these, [9]hypermart.net was too late
for inclusion in the November survey, but is likely to add several
hundred thousand in December. hypermart.net provides free business
site hosting on a Linux/Apache [10]platform.
Intel based systems have done very well in hosting scenarios over the
last two years, and this trend is likely to continue, both as a
platform for the freely available Linux and FreeBSD operating systems
and for Windows 2000 with the new Microsoft operating system now being
heavily promoted as scaling to high availability and high performance
hosting scenarios.
Notable Sites - What do the top .com domains use for encrypted
transactions?
At the start of the month Netscape made the news when it became clear
that retailing icon amazon.com had replaced Netscape with the
Stronghold server on [11]www.amazon.com. Netscape's steadily declining
share of the SSL Server market has been chronicled by the [12]SSL
Survey over the last three years, which has seen strong gains for both
Microsoft and Apache based servers over the same period. Loss of the
amazon.com site, which never upgraded from Netscape-Commerce, has been
taken as an indication that top commerce sites see Netscape as a spent
force.
However, a quick analysis of the commercial domains most active in
using encrypted transactions on the internet shows that Netscape still
enjoys a considerable presence with the large corporate users that it
has always seen as its primary market, and it is often the case that
the most intensive users of a particular technology behave differently
to the userbase as a whole.
The top 10 .com domains with the most distinct certificates found by
the September SSL survey, run 213 Netscape servers [out of a total of
341 sites], against 42 Microsoft [of which 28 are in the microsoft.com
domain], and 24 Apache. Equally notable is their choice of operating
systems, where both NT and Linux, strongly represented in the SSL
Survey as a whole have a relatively small share. Just 57 sites run NT,
with the most common Unix systems according to signatures detected in
the tcp/ip characteristics, being Solaris and AIX. Only one site was
detected as running Linux.
Having three operating systems manufacturers in the top ten domains
obviously helps make the o/s figures anomalous, but even so it is
clear that the commercial Unix vendors do much better with the larger
electronic commerce companies than with the internet economy as a
whole. Equally interesting is the composition of the list; when a
similar "top 10" list was constructed in the spring, it was packed out
with retail brokerages; while these are still very intensive users of
SSL, they have been pushed out of the top 10 by a combination of large
banks and computer vendors catching up in the use of encrypted
transactions.
Top 10 .com domains with most SSL third party certificates
Domain
1. schwab.com
2. ibm.com
3. hp.com
4. microsoft.com
5. photonet.com
6. nationsbankonline.com
7. att.com
8. yahoo.com
9. credit-agricole.fr
10 bankoneonline.com
